Hi, just joined as I'm looking into buying an RX 400h. Congratulations on the forum, I've already picked out a lot of useful info.

What I would really like to check though is this...with my budget of 8-10K, I am looking at a 2007-9 SE-L or SE with Nav and a FSH, with anything between 60-100k in mileage. Given that some of these are high mileage and 8 years old, what is the expected lifespan of the electric motors and batteries?

Would it be better to go for newer and high mileage or older and low mileage? Obviously I'd prefer newer and low mileage but that all depends on finding a good one.

I'm off to have a look at a couple local to me near Manchester, so there seem to be a few around to look at. What would members think I should also look at on the test drive? Other bits that might be specific to hybrid?

Hi. I think all things are covered petty much in the forum already.

I have RX400h SE-L. 86000 miles.. Batteries are perfect and car has no rattles or issues whatsoever. So, if you had a good one that has been looked after you will be fine. Good luck. Let us know how you get on.

I remember reading somewhere that the high voltage batteries will be about 80% efficient after 10 years. I would go for the SE-L, as the price won't be much higher and you will get a lot of useful extra features. The consensus seems to be to go for younger higher mileage cars.
